Good evening all, I am struggling to remove the flywheel / magneto on a Mk2. I have tried various pullers and they are either too small to fit the diameter of the magneto, or the hooks on the legs are too wide to fit inside the crankcase. Before I start grinding down the legs of a puller, am I missing something simple?

I have something similar to the above. Makes the job easy and less likely to damage something. Might be worth checking the thread sizes, but the one I have, has fitted various other bikes.
